These Cheesy Garlic Pesto Chicken Sliders are a delicious and easy-to-make appetizer or meal. Perfect for gatherings or a quick family dinner, these sliders are packed with flavor and gooey cheese.
Ingredients

Slider Rolls:
- 12 count package slider rolls
Garlic Butter Mixture:
- 6 Tbsp unsalted butter, melted
- 4 cloves garlic, finely minced
- 2 tsp minced fresh parsley
Pesto Chicken Filling:
- 2/3 cup basil pesto, homemade or store-bought (divided)
- 2 cups cooked and shredded chicken
- 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- Salt and pepper, to taste
Instructions
- Preheat Oven and Prepare Pan: Preheat oven to 375°F and grease a 9×13-inch baking pan.
- Prepare Slider Rolls: Slice the slider rolls horizontally and place the bottom half in the prepared pan.
- Make Garlic Butter Mixture: Combine melted butter, minced garlic, and parsley in a bowl.
- Layer Ingredients: Spread half of the pesto on the bottom rolls, layer chicken and cheese, then add remaining pesto and top rolls.
- Brush and Season: Brush the garlic butter over the rolls, sprinkle with salt and pepper.
- Bake: Cover with foil and bake for 10 minutes, then uncover and bake for another 5-10 minutes until cheese is melted.
Notes
- You can customize these sliders with additional toppings like sliced tomatoes or arugula.
- For a crispier top, broil the sliders for a few minutes after baking.
